Because Galactica is a decommissioned model Battlestar, they're barely able to stock up on ballistic weaponary without having to adapt weapons to FTL capability. There's probably not many engineers left to develop FLT, only repair. Adapting FLT to weaponary might mean they'll have to cannibalise other ships in the fleet to do so, and with the fact they have a survival tally at the beginning of every episode, they're not willing to do that are they?

So, yeah, maybe they would use a spare FTL engine, from colonial one, (weren't they carrying a couple in the pilot movie?) or cannabalised from a raider / small fleet ship.
If you're being attacked by three basestars and all you need to do is sacrifice three remote controlled FTL bomb ships, instead of letting them waste your viper pilots and nuke you, what would you do?
Not only that, but with the advent of FTL, you really should have come up with FTL bomb tactics, right, right after the first military commander found out about it.
1) FTL + Bomb, = exploding bomb inside basestar.
2) FTL + asteroid, = asteroid 'inside' basestar / asteroid far too close to planet or asteroid moving very fast AT basestar.
3) FTL + small ship, but FTL drive geared up for big ship = getting the small ship in close, then jumping away taking a portion of the basestar with you, to the center of the sun or whatnot.
4) FTL + nuke = Nuke very close to basestar, too close to destroy.
and so on, maybe.
